۱۳۸۹ بهمن ۱۳, چهارشنبه

نصب درایور wifi در گنو/لینوکس

در این پست قصد دارم طریقه نصب درایور wifi رو از روی سورس و برای مدلهایی که Broadcom 802.11 هستند را بگم.



برای این کار باید به سایت broadcom برویم و درایور مربوطه رو بسته به ۳۲بیت یا ۶۴بیت بودن سیستم عامل دانلود کنیم.


پس از دانلود بسته مربوطه آنرا extract میکنیم و از طریق خط فرمان به دایرکتوری آن میرویم. پس برای اینکار دستورات زیر را داریم:


tar xzf <path>/hybrid-portsrc_x86-32_v5.100.82.38.tar.gz


cd <path>/hybrid-portsrc_x86_32-v5_100_82_38    for 32bit os


cd <path>/hybrid-portsrc_x86_64-v5_100_82_38    for 64bit os


سپس برای شروع نصب دستور زیر را میزنیم :


make


پس از این مرحله و در صورت عدم مشاهده هیچ پیام خطایی به مرحله بعد میرویم و دستورات زیر را در خط فرمان وارد میکنیم:


sudo rmmod b43


sudo rmmod ssb


sudo rmmod wl


sudo echo "blacklist ssb" >> /etc/modprobe.d/blacklist.conf


sudo echo "blacklist b43" >> /etc/modprobe.d/blacklist.conf


و


sudo modprobe lib80211


or


sudo modprobe ieee80211_crypt_tkip


و در آخر :


sudo insmod wl.ko


برای لود شدن درایور در بوت از دستور زیر استفاده میکنیم:


sudo cp wl.ko /lib/modules/`uname -r`/kernel/drivers/net/wireless


sudo depmod -a


و در نهایت سیستم را reboot میکنیم.


--


پ.ن۱ :‌اگر تمامی مراحل فوق بدون مشاهده هیچ پیام خطایی انجام شود پس از ریستارت درایور لود میشود.


پ.ن۲ :برای مطالعه بیشتر میتوانید از فایل readme در این آدرس استفاده کنید. لازم به ذکر است جهت نصب در سایر توزیع های خانواده گنو/لینوکس میتوان از این فایل استفاده کرد.


پ.ن۳: این مراحل در دبیان ،مینت دبیان و اوبونتو تست شده و به درستی عمل میکنند.

۱ نظر:

  1. [...] برد. پ.ن ۲: روش دیگر (روش کلی برای هر توزیعی) برای نصب را در این پست گفته [...]

    پاسخحذف